The company ZARIFOPOULOS S.A. supports the DIATROFI Program

The company ZARIFOPOULOS S.A. supports the DIATROFI Program for the school year 2016-2017 by offering 225lt of organic extra virgin olive oil to be used for the preparation of meals for students in public schools participating in the Program.

The Hellenic Initiative supports the DIATROFI Program for a second consecutive year

The Hellenic Initiative (THI) will continue to support students in need through the DIATROFI Program for the school year 2016-17. With the grant offered by THI, 24,000 healthy meals will be distributed to 1,008 students of 8 schools participating in the DIATROFI Program.
